LCUIComponents is an on-going project, which supports creating transient views appearing above other content onscreen when a control is selected. Currently, the framework provides supports to simply create a customiZable popover with a selectable data list.
LCUIComponents

Related Posts
AnimatedBottomBar
A customizable and easy to use bottom bar view with sleek animations